Agriculture is not the same as it was twenty years ago, and it won’t be the same twenty years from now. Climate conditions are changing. The world needs more food from the same arable land. Consumer preferences and regulations are evolving. Public expectations are rising and accountability matters more. And farmers need to respond to these changing dynamics - they are at the core of our food system and our planet.

Granular creates Farm Management Software and land valuation software, AcreValue, that empowers farms to become more valuable businesses, for today and for the future. We take a user-centric development and design approach to develop products that are simple to use that our farmers love! We are a startup funded by top investors (Andreessen and Horowitz, Google Ventures, Khosla Ventures and Tao Capital).
